DRIVER OF THE DAY: Vettel's hard-charging Texan drive gets your vote

Yet again four-time champion Sebastian Vettel showed that looming retirement has done nothing to blunt his racecraft. Starting P10, Vettel led the Grand Prix at one point, before a 17-second pit stop prompted an amazing fightback, which culminated in him winning a wheel-to-wheel dice with Kevin Magnussen on the very last lap to finish P8. Here’s how the voting broke down…
Sebastian Vettel - 18.4%
Lewis Hamilton - 18%
Fernando Alonso - 15%
Charles Leclerc - 10.3%
Max Verstappen - 10.2%
